Design and Operation of the Fn Scar 16

The Fn Scar 16 uses a compact short-stroke gas piston positioned above the barrel. When a cartridge is fired, a measured amount of gas is redirected through a tuned port to drive a piston a short distance. This synchronized motion cycles the bolt and resets the action with controlled energy, which reduces recoil impulse and preserves accuracy during rapid fire.
Because the piston only moves a short distance, the system experiences less heat transfer to the bolt carrier group and receiver compared to longer-stroke designs. This contributes to steadier recoil and lower wear over time, which is why many shooters consider the Fn Scar 16 reliable across a wide range of ammunition and environmental conditions.

Maintenance and Durability of the Fn Scar 16
Maintenance routines for the Fn Scar 16 focus on the piston assembly, gas port, and seals. Regular inspection of the piston rod, piston head, and gas port size can prevent gradual timing shifts. The system’s coatings and materials are chosen for resistance to heat, corrosion, and wear, helping it hold up under harsh service conditions.
Cleaning should be thorough but not abrasive—use the recommended solvents and brushes to remove carbon buildup, then lubricate the moving surfaces to maintain smooth operation. The short-stroke design makes disassembly straightforward, which reduces downtime when servicing in the field.
